Silver chloride kept in a china dish turns grey in sunlight.(a)Write the colour of silver chloride when it was kept in the china dish.(b)Name the type of chemical reaction taking place and write the chemical equation for the reaction.(c)State one use of the reaction. Name one more chemical which can be used for the same purpose.
Silver chloride kept in a china dish turns grey in sunlight.
(a)
Write the colour of silver chloride when it was kept in the china dish.
(b)
Name the type of chemical reaction taking place and write the chemical equation for the reaction.
(c)
State one use of the reaction. Name one more chemical which can be used for the same purpose.
Marking-scheme solution
(a) White
(b) Decomposition reaction / Photolytic decomposition
\[2 \mathrm{AgCl} \xrightarrow{\text { Sunlight }} 2 \mathrm{Ag}+\mathrm{Cl}_{2}
\]
(c) used in black and white photography ; AgBr / Silver Bromide
